## Executive Snapshot
**What it is:** Desktop is a utility app for ISP subscribers to manage billing and service status on iOS and Android.
**Why users hire it:** Users hire the app to resolve payment and service access friction without calling support, saving time on routine administrative tasks.
<!-- /section:executive-snapshot -->

<!-- section:features -->
## App DNA (Features & Intent)
- **[Standard] Boleto Issuance:** Generates second copies of payment slips for internet service plans
- **[Differentiator] Trust-based Unlocking:** Allows temporary service restoration for users with pending payments
